The Danaher AHR115C6-88S motor is a part of the Slo-Syn Synchronous Motors series and delivers up to 1500 oz-in of torque. It operates at 72 RPM at 60 Hz or 60 RPM at 50 Hz and offers both 120V and 240V AC versions. The motor features a patented RRC network ensuring smooth operation and supports maintenance-free use.

Product Description:
Danaher produces the AHR115C6-88S Synchronous motor as a product of its Slo-Syn synchronous motors series. This motor enables industrial automation systems to conduct precise movement control through reliable mechanical operation. Operating at 530V voltage the servo motor accepts inputs from 50 Hz and 60 Hz frequency signals.
A three-phase power system drives the AHR115C6-88S synchronous motor to distribute energy effectively. This servo motor demonstrates a stall torque ability of 6.8 Nm at all times thus providing steady operation when subjected to fixed loads. The rated motor current is set at 35 A so the motor produces strong operations in different operating environments. The unit provides 6000 rpm maximum speed to perform quick automated processes efficiently. The 24V DC brake system of AHR115C6-88S synchronous motor operates to offer controlled stopping and secure positioning for the motor. The system becomes more reliable due to this feature when operations pause temporarily. The IP rating of IP 64/65 offers protection against dust and water ingress. The rating demonstrates that this motor can function properly in industrial facilities which typically encounter particle or moisture exposure. This motor system consists of 1 kg weight which enables users to utilize its compact design in limited space areas. The motor operates autonomously without maintenance requirements which minimizes service interruptions together with support expenses.
Users have two connection possibilities when installing the AHR115C6-88S synchronous motor because it supports lead terminals as well as terminal box settings.
